Auth. (admin+) Stored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ability in Muneeb ur Rehman Simple PopUp plugin <= 1.8.6 versions.

Explanation of Vulnerability in Simple Terms

02Summary

Simple PopUp versions up to 1.8.6 contain a stored c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ability. An authenticated administrator can inject malicious JavaScript into popup content that executes in the browsers of site visitors. The vulnerability requires an admin to create or edit a popup and a user to view the affected page. This can lead to session hijacking, credential theft, or malware distribution to site visitors.

What an attacker can do

03Attacker Capabilities

Inject malicious JavaScript that runs in visitors' browsers when they view a popup.

Potential impact on your site

04Site Impact

A compromised admin account can inject malware or steal visitor data through popups without code access.

Conditions required to exploit

05Prerequisites

Attacker must have administrator privileges and a visitor must view the page containing the popup.
